Junior Hunting Day set in Harwinton
HARWINTON — The Harwinton Rod & Gun Club will host its annual Junior Hunting Day on Saturday, Oct. 13, starting at 8 a.m., “to provide Connecticut-licensed junior hunters an opportunity to experience the joy of pheasant hunting in a controlled, instructional environment,” according to club members.
Junior hunters will hunt over trained dogs on our 80-acre property located in Colebrook, Connecticut. All junior hunters will be accompanied by experienced licensed hunters during the event.
This event is open to the public. You do not need to be a member of HRG to participate. There is no fee associated with this event. This event is made possible through the efforts of the Harwinton Rod & Gun Club and volunteers.
All junior hunters will be expected to possess a valid Connecticut junior hunting license ; be between the ages of 12 - 15 ; be accompanied by a parent or guardian on the day of the event (adults cannot hunt) ; bring their own shotgun, ammunition, fluorescent orange clothing, shooting glasses, and hearing protection; and obey all Connecticut hunting laws.
